Question1: It is desired to stake out a 300-ft spiral curve for transition into a 4°0000" circular curve (arc definition). The PI is at station 70+00 and the intersection angle I has been measured and found to be 50°0000". Compute the deflection angles and chords (i.c. stake out notes) for staking out the curve at 50-ft stations.


Qucstion 2 : For the spiral curve in Question, compute the long chord (L.C), long tangent (L.T), short tangent (ST) and the spiral tangent length (T)


Question 3 : For the spiral curve in Question 1, compute the deflection angles and chords (i.e., stake out notes) for staking out the curve if the spiral is divided into 5 equal chords.
